So I have been watching others on here and debating with myself about how to "show up" in my community. How much of myself can I safely express and reveal? What would people say or think? Would they take me seriously?.. etc etc. I keep going back to that day during NYC IRL when I met Goose and his peeps and learned about having a bold theme that I can get excited about, one that sets the culture and tone for the community. The importance of inside jokes. The idea that when you, as a community host, are having fun, that energy is contagious and connective. When I first created my community, I was playing it safe. I wanted to be taken seriously. I wanted things to feel calm, professional, and serene. And while that worked… it also wasn’t the full expression of me. Am I thoughtful and grounded? Yes. But I’m also a bit irreverent. A bit cheeky. A bit fiery. So yesterday I made a bold move. What used to be Real Talk for Singles 50+ is now Find Love After 50. And what used to be a muted stock photos theme is now a very intentional Seinfeld-inspired vibe—complete with familiar images, inside jokes, and a nod to the awkwardness of dating that so many of us recognize. [Before and After pics attached below]. Will everyone love it or approve? Probably not. And that’s ok. That’s not the point. The point is that I’m having fun. I’m trying something new. I’m letting my freak flag fly. The people who love it will likely stay longer and feel more connected. Those who don’t? They may still stick around just for the “show”—who knows. 😉 What I do know is this: when the host feels energized and alive, that energy spills into the entire community. Shout out to @Brian Rushalski , @Sam Greiner and @Goose Dunlavey for inspiration! Let me know what bold moves or theme you've adopted for your community and why it's working for you.
